The Subfloor Water Extraction Process: What to Expect

With subfloor water extraction, the process itself is just as important as the equipment and techniques used. Our team follows a strict protocol to ensure that every inch of affected subfloor is thoroughly dried and restored to its original condition. We use advanced equipment, such as industrial-strength wet vacuums and heavy-duty drying fans, to speed up the process and prevent further damage.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team assesses the extent of the damage to find out the best course of action. We’ll identify the source of the leak or flood, and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ry the subfloor.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using our industrial-strength wet vacuums and pumps, we remove the standing water from your subfloor.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Next, we use our heavy-duty drying fans and dehumidifiers to dry the subfloor and surrounding areas.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ring that the affected area is completely dry and free of moisture.

Step 4: Monitoring and Verification

Our team will monitor the affected area to ensure that the subfloor is completely dry and free of moisture. We use specialized equipment to verify that the area has returned to a safe and healthy humidity level.

Subfloor Water Extraction Cost in Landis, NC

The cost of subfloor water extraction services in Landis, NC can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. On average, you can expect to pay between $500-$2,500 for a subfloor water extraction service. But, prices can range from $200-$5,000 or more, depending on the specific needs of your home.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Subfloor Water Extraction $500-$2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Dehumidification and Drying $200-$1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of service
Equipment Rental and Usage $50-$500 Type of equipment used, duration of service, and rental fees
Insurance Claims Documentation $0-$500 Complexity of claims process, number of documents required
